Roasted Butternut Squash with Baby Spinach & Cranberries

Sweet squash, tangy cranberries, and fresh spinach create a colorful, favorite dish.

Ingredients

Servings: 12

  • 2 pkgs (20 oz each) Wegmans Cleaned & Cut Butternut Squash, cut in 1-inch pieces

  • 2 red onions, peeled, chopped (about 4 cups)

  • 3 Tbsp Wegmans Basting Oil

  • Salt and pepper to taste

  • 1 pkg (6 oz) Wegmans Fresh Baby Spinach

  • 3/4 cup Wegmans Sweetened Dried Cranberries

Directions

  • Step 1

    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Toss squash, onions, and basting oil in large bowl; season with salt and pepper. Arrange in single layer on parchment paper-lined baking sheet.
  • Step 2

    Roast about 35 min, until lightly browned and tender. Add spinach and dried cranberries; toss to combine.

Pro Tip

Try adding diced Wegmans Mild Fresh Goat Cheese along with spinach and cranberries for additional flavor.
